- 1). Visit the official website for the Texas Office of the Inspector General, which is listed in the Resources section of this article.
- 2). Click the "Reporting Waste, Abuse, & Fraud" link that is located on the left-hand side of the page.
- 3). Select the link labeled "Click Here To File Reports Online."
- 4). Click the "Go To Part 1" button that is located at the bottom of the page. Complete the online form by entering all of the details surrounding the fraud, including the name of the parties involved. After submitting the online form, be sure to write down the reference number and maintain it for your own records.
- 5). Telephone the Office of the Inspector General at 800-436-6184 to report the food stamp fraud, if you don't want to report it online. By calling this hotline number, a live representative will document your allegations of food stamp fraud. The hours of hotline operation are Monday through Friday from 7:30 a.m. to 6:00 p.m. CST.
